在网站建设与维护过程中,FTP(文件传输协议)是一种常用的工具,用于将网站文件上传至服务器。有时在完成FTP上传后,我们可能会遇到网站无法访问的问题。本文将针对这一问题,深入分析可能的原因及解决方案。
问题分析
1. 域名解析问题:上传后无法访问可能源于域名解析不正确,即域名与服务器IP地址的对应关系未正确设置。
2. FTP上传错误:文件可能未正确上传至服务器指定目录,或上传过程中文件损坏。
3. 服务器配置问题:服务器配置错误(如Apache、Nginx等)可能导致网站无法正常访问。
4. 权限设置:文件或目录的权限设置不当,可能导致网站无法被正确执行或访问。
解决策略
1. 域名解析检查
确认域名是否已正确解析至服务器IP地址。
检查DNS设置,确保域名解析无误。
2. FTP上传检查
检查FTP上传日志,确认文件是否已成功上传至指定目录。
如发现文件损坏或部分上传,需重新上传完整文件。
3. 服务器配置检查与调整
检查Apache、Nginx等服务器软件的配置文件,确保网站运行所需的相关模块已启用。
如有必要,可咨询服务器管理员或专业人士进行配置调整。
4. 权限设置
检查文件和目录的权限设置,确保网站程序可以正常读取和执行所需文件。
使用chmod和chown等命令调整文件和目录权限。
5. 检查服务器资源
确认服务器是否因资源不足(如内存、CPU等)导致网站无法正常运行。
如资源不足,可考虑升级服务器配置或优化网站代码以降低资源消耗。
6. 网站程序检查
检查网站程序是否正常运行,如有错误提示或异常日志,需根据提示进行修复。
如发现程序本身存在问题,可联系开发团队进行修复或更新。
后续预防措施
1. 定期备份网站数据,以防数据丢失或损坏。
2. 定期检查服务器安全性和性能,确保网站稳定运行。
3. 学习并掌握基本的FTP上传和服务器管理知识,以便在出现问题时能够快速解决。
4. 建立完善的网站维护和更新流程,确保网站始终保持最新状态。
FTP上传网站后无法访问的问题可能由多种原因导致,我们需要从多个方面进行检查和排查。通过本文提供的解决策略和预防措施,我们可以更好地应对这一问题,确保网站的正常访问和稳定运行。